Output 18ab7135b29fd425e64c0fd0c642576decfbb5c640dafcbe9415c325f490691e:0

value
10559172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88fc61b3f99cc843287553b7531b78a20af73a3 OP_EQUAL
address
3MS67ZXQXjQ4HgzyeMNMvTcMhknMtgkEev
transaction
18ab7135b29fd425e64c0fd0c642576decfbb5c640dafcbe9415c325f490691e
spent
true